Too Many Lies Profile

Too Many Lies is a 9 year old bay gelding. Too Many Lies is trained by Justin Bawden, at Mount Isa and owned by Ms J Montgomery.

Too Many Lies’s last race event was at 28/04/2018 and it has not been nominated for any upcoming race.

Too Many Lies Racing Form

Career form is 5 wins, 5 seconds, 4 thirds from 31 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$39,425.

With a 16% Win Percentage and 45% Place Percentage. Too Many Lies's last race event was at Mt Isa.

Exposed form for its last starts is 4-7-5-9-7.
